The year 2020 marks the 5th cycle of the Guangzhou International Award for Urban Innovation (Guangzhou Award). During these past years the award has developed into a true platform for the sharing of innovative practices in powered by the award winning local governments and linked with the global agendas, in particular United Nation’s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and New Urban Agenda (NUA).
Its objective is to contribute to the creation of inclusive, safe, resilient and sustainable cities and human settlements.
The Guangzhou Award invites your city, local or regional government or association (LGA) to submit ongoing or recently completed innovative initiatives related to the themes highlighted by the SDGs and the commitments of NUA.
The criteria that are applied to the Guangzhou Award assessment include: innovativeness, effectiveness, replicability/transferability, significance and relevance of the initiative to the Sustainable Development Goals and the New Urban Agenda. The aim of the Guangzhou Award is to recognize innovation in improving social, economic and environmental sustainability in cities and regions and, in so doing, to advance the prosperity and quality of life of their citizens.
